Stalled Weight Loss on Keto: Common Mistakes and Solutions

Embarking on a ketogenic diet is a robust plan to achieve rapid weight loss by drastically reducing carbohydrate intake and replacing it with healthy fats. However, many individuals report a halt in their weight loss journey within a few months. Here we delve into the common reasons behind the stall in weight loss on a keto diet and provide practical solutions.

Understanding the Keto Weight Loss Plateau

While some people experience continued weight loss on the keto diet, others may hit a weight loss plateau after a few months. This stall can occur due to various factors, including metabolic adaptation, hidden carbs, excessive calorie intake, and hormonal imbalances.

Metabolic adaptation is a natural response where your body becomes more efficient at using stored fat for energy. However, this can slow down weight loss and prevent further progress. Hidden carbs are another common factor, as many foods may contain more sugar and carbohydrates than expected, making it difficult to maintain a strict ketogenic diet.

Factors Contributing to the Plateau

To overcome the weight loss plateau, it's crucial to reassess your dietary habits and make necessary adjustments. Here are some common factors and their solutions:

1. Metabolic Adaptation

When your body adapts to a ketogenic diet, it becomes more efficient at using fat stores for energy. To combat this, you may need to increase caloric intake or adjust your macronutrient ratios to maintain a caloric deficit. Ensuring you stay in a state of ketosis is also important. Consuming less than 50 grams of carbohydrates per day is generally recommended for beginners to stay in ketosis.

2. Hidden Carbs

Many foods contain hidden carbs, including vegetables, condiments, and cooking oils. By accurately tracking your macros, you can identify and reduce these hidden carbs. Utilize apps like MyFitnessPal to track your intake and ensure compliance with your ketogenic diet.

3. Excessive Calorie Intake

Even on a low-carb, high-fat diet, it's possible to consume too many calories and not achieve weight loss. Keep a daily log of your meals and snacks to ensure you're not exceeding your caloric needs for weight loss. Moderation is key, especially when indulging in keto-friendly treats.

4. Hormonal Imbalances

Hormonal imbalances such as thyroid dysfunction or stress can impact weight loss. Consulting with a healthcare professional or a nutritionist can provide personalized insights and suggest necessary remedies.

Other Considerations

Physical activity and stress management are also important factors in maintaining a healthy weight. Incorporating regular workouts can boost metabolic rate and help you burn more calories. Managing stress through techniques like meditation or yoga can reduce cortisol levels and aid in weight loss.
